Abstract

An absorbent article having relatively light weight and less bulk includes a liquid permeable top layer, an inner surge layer, and a substantially liquid-impermeable outer cover. A plurality of pockets are formed in at least one of the surge layer and the outer cover material. The pockets contain a superabsorbent material. The surge layer or outer cover material containing the pockets functions as an absorbent layer, thereby eliminating the need for a separate (often bulky) absorbent layer between the surge layer and the outer cover.
